Day 1: Embrace the Essence of Helsinki

Morning: Market Square and Suomenlinna Sea Fortress

Start your day at the bustling Market Square (Kauppatori), the heart of Helsinki’s outdoor markets. Here, you can sample local delicacies like creamy salmon soup or grab a cup of steaming coffee. The aroma of fresh fish and the sight of colorful fruits will invigorate your senses. Next, hop on a ferry to the Suomenlinna Sea Fortress, a UNESCO World Heritage site. This maritime fortress is a cultural treasure, and exploring its ramparts offers stunning views of the archipelago.

Afternoon: Explore Design District and Esplanadi Park

Back in the city, wander through the Design District, a hub for creativity and Finnish design. Peek into boutique shops, art galleries, and studios to witness the iconic minimalist style. Afterward, stroll along the Esplanadi, a green oasis lined with cafes and shops. It’s the perfect spot to people-watch or enjoy a picnic with treats from local vendors.

Evening: Dinner and Nightlife in Kallio

As evening falls, head to the Kallio district, known for its bohemian vibe and eclectic dining scene. Indulge in traditional Finnish cuisine or international flavors at one of the many restaurants. After dinner, experience Helsinki’s nightlife. From cozy pubs to trendy bars, there’s something for every taste. Don’t miss the chance to try a Finnish craft beer or a cloudberry cocktail!

Day 2: Discover Hidden Gems and Relax in Nature

Morning: Breakfast at a Local Café and Visit to Löyly Sauna

Begin with breakfast at a cozy café, savoring a korvapuusti (cinnamon bun) alongside your coffee. Next, embrace the Finnish tradition of sauna at Löyly, an architectural marvel on the waterfront. The combination of steam and a dip in the Baltic Sea is an invigorating experience that you won’t forget.

Afternoon: Art and Culture at Helsinki’s Museums

Refreshed from the sauna, delve into Helsinki’s art scene. The Kiasma Museum of Contemporary Art showcases thought-provoking exhibits. Alternatively, the Ateneum Art Museum offers a look at Finnish classics. Both are a testament to the city’s rich cultural tapestry.

Evening: Relaxing Dinner and Scenic Walk

For dinner, choose a restaurant with a view of the water or nestled in a historic building. Helsinki’s culinary scene is a blend of innovation and tradition, so you’re in for a treat. Cap off your weekend with a leisurely walk along the Töölönlahti Bay. The tranquil waters and city lights create a serene backdrop for reflection on your whirlwind weekend.

Frequently Asked Questions

  • What’s the best way to get around Helsinki?

    Public transportation in Helsinki is efficient and user-friendly. Trams, buses, and the metro can get you to most attractions. For a unique experience, rent a city bike or simply explore on foot.

  • Can I see the Northern Lights in Helsinki?

    While it’s possible, Helsinki’s urban lights make it less likely. For the best chance to witness the Aurora borealis, plan a trip further north in Finland during the winter months.

  • Is Helsinki a budget-friendly city?

    Helsinki can be enjoyed on any budget. While some attractions have entrance fees, many parks and landmarks are free. Eating like a local at markets and choosing public transport can help save euros.
